Recognizing Termite Behavior



To comprehend termite actions, observe their patterns of activity and feeding routines closely. Termites are social insects that collaborate in huge colonies to forage for food. They interact with pheromones, which help them coordinate their activities and situate food sources successfully. As they search for cellulose-rich products to feed upon, termites develop distinct passages and mud tubes to secure themselves from predators and keep a secure atmosphere.

Termites are most energetic throughout warmer months when they can easily access food sources and duplicate rapidly. They're brought in to damp and worn out timber, making homes with moisture issues specifically at risk to problems. By recognizing their behavior, you can recognize prospective entry factors and take safety nets to shield your home.

Keep an eye out for signs of termite activity, such as disposed of wings, mud tubes, and hollow-sounding timber. By being proactive and dealing with any kind of issues quickly, you can decrease the threat of termite damages and make sure the long-lasting stability of your home.

Reliable Termite Therapy Choices



Take into consideration executing targeted termite treatments to eradicate existing infestations and protect against future termite damages. When dealing with termite infestations, it's vital to pick the most efficient therapy choices readily available.

Here are some suggestions to help you tackle your termite issue efficiently:

- ** Liquid Termiticides **: Applied to the dirt around the perimeter of your home, fluid termiticides develop a protective obstacle that avoids termites from getting in the structure.

- ** Bait Stations **: Lure stations are purposefully placed around your residential or commercial property to attract termites. Once termites feed upon the bait, they lug it back to their colony, effectively getting rid of the entire termite population.



- ** Timber Treatments **: Timber treatments involve applying specialized products directly to plagued timber or susceptible locations. These treatments can help get rid of existing termites and safeguard versus future infestations.
